5 Tips on How to be a Stress-free Bride on your Big Day

1. Ease Into the Day with a Morning Just for You

Don’t rush into the chaos. Your wedding morning should feel like a breath of fresh air, not a sprint to the altar. Whether you journal with a cup of coffee, throw on a playlist that makes you smile (mine would definitely have some Beyoncé), or do a quick meditation, make space for something that centers you. Set the tone early, and you’ll carry that calm through the rest of the day.


2. Trust the Team You've Built (Seriously, Let Go!)

You’ve done the planning. You’ve made the decisions. Now it’s time to trust your vendors and let them do what they do best. Letting go of control might feel scary, but it’s the only way to actually enjoy your day instead of managing it. Your only job? Get married and have the time of your life.



3. Schedule a Few Mini Time-Outs

Wedding days can feel like they’re over in the blink of an eye. Build in a few intentional pauses. Maybe sneak away with your partner for five minutes after the ceremony, or find a quiet moment to breathe and just feel all the joy around you. These little breaks are like emotional espresso shots—quick but powerful.


4. Embrace the Unexpected (Yes, Even the Weird Stuff)

Something will go slightly off-script. A flower might wilt. Your ring bearer might lose his shoe. But here’s the thing: none of that can take away from the magic of the moment you say “I do.” Keep your eyes on the heart of the day—you’re marrying your person. That’s the real win.

5. Keep Your Inner Circle Close

Choose your wedding day crew like you’d choose your apocalypse team. You want people who calm you down, make you laugh, and hand you snacks when your blood sugar crashes. Bridesmaids, family, your planner—they’re your emotional safety net. Lean on them when you need to, and let them lift you up.


Final Thoughts: Stay Present and Celebrate Your Way

If there’s one final tip I’d give every bride, it’s this: soak it all in. Look around. Feel the love. Breathe in the laughter, the hugs, the clink of glasses. The day goes fast, but your memories of it will last a lifetime, especially if you’re present enough to make them.
